"Relive the 2nd grade in this former mansion turned schoolhouse turned co-op building on the ""Gold Coast"" of Clinton Hill, Brooklyn. This unique duplex apartment features the charm of Victorian Brooklyn throughout. High ceilings, a gorgeous wood-burning fireplace, original floors, decorative moldings adorn the space facing the quiet back of the building. With three exposures the lower level gets exceptional lighting and has lovely tree-lined views. The windowed kitchen has butcher block countertops, abundant cabinet space and a charming farmhouse sink. The large living room is centered on the ornate fireplace, yet has room for a home office space as well. A dining area adjacent to the kitchen boasts stylish lighting and room to host friends and family. An outdoor terrace off the living room allows for lovely al fresco dining or lounging. The secondary bedroom is located off of the living room and features two exposures with extra large windows. An en-suite full bathroom has been recently renovated with classic Carrara marble tile. Up the stairs you will feel that you've been transported to a dreamy, secret hideout as you enter the enchanting primary suite. A peaked ceiling with exposed wood beams and brick details is like living in a fairytale. At over 650sq ft this second floor has immense possibilities. There is currently a half bathroom that could be expanded as well as abundant storage and room for sleeping, lounging and working. 321 Clinton Ave is one of a collection of distinctive mansions in Clinton Hill Brooklyn. Converted to apartments in 1987, this 12-unit building plus 2 carriage houses features a lovely front garden, a stately stoop with grand front doors, common storage for the residents, a part-time porter, and free laundry. This one-of-a-kind building is ideally located down the block from the G train, and the C train a few blocks away. Dekalb Avenue s restaurant row is just around the corner and you are less than half a mile to Fort Greene Park. Pet friendly. Assessment $224/month through 1/27."
